777权限是一种文件或文件夹的权限配置,其中7表示拥有者(owner)有读、写和执行的权限,7表示所属组(group)用户有读、写和执行的权限,7表示其他用户(others)有读、写和执行的权限。
有些文件夹需要配置777权限是因为这些文件夹需要对所有用户开放读写执行的权限。通常情况下,文件夹的默认权限为755,其中7表示拥有者有读、写和执行的权限,5表示所属组用户有读和执行的权限,5表示其他用户有读和执行的权限。这意味着只有拥有者具有写权限,而其他用户只能读取和执行该文件夹中的内容。
然而,当某些应用程序或服务需要对文件夹进行写入、修改和执行操作时,需要将文件夹的权限配置为777,以便所有用户都可以对该目录进行读写操作。这样做的目的是为了方便程序或服务的正常运行,以及确保所有用户都具有相应的权限来访问文件夹中的内容。
例如,在网站服务器上,如果某个文件夹需要允许用户进行上传文件操作,那么这个文件夹需要设置为777权限,以便所有用户都可以将文件上传到该文件夹中。同样地,如果一个应用程序需要在运行过程中生成、修改或访问某个目录下的文件,那么这个目录也需要配置为777权限,以便应用程序可以正常执行相应的操作。
然而,配置777权限也存在一些安全风险。因为777权限将允许所有用户都可以进行读写和执行操作,这包括不受信任的用户。如果对一个重要的文件夹配置了777权限,那么可能会导致潜在的安全漏洞,例如未经授权的用户可能会更改或删除该文件夹中的重要文件。
因此,在配置777权限时需要谨慎操作,只在确实需要所有用户都访问和操作文件夹内容的情况下使用。在其他情况下,应根据具体需求和安全考虑,适当限制和控制文件夹的权限配置,以保护文件和系统的安全。